backstreets

[US]/[ˈbækˌstriːts]/
[UK]/[ˈbækˌstriːts]/
Frequency: Very High

Translation

n.less important or fashionable streets in a town or city; a place that is hidden or difficult to find

Example Sentences

we wandered through the backstreets, getting delightfully lost.

the film showcased the gritty reality of the city's backstreets.

local artists often find inspiration in the backstreets' hidden beauty.

the backstreets were quiet and deserted late at night.

he knew the backstreets like the back of his hand.

the restaurant was tucked away in the backstreets, a true hidden gem.

despite the danger, some sought refuge in the backstreets.

the backstreets offered a glimpse into a different side of the city.

we discovered a charming cafe hidden down the backstreets.

the police patrolled the backstreets to deter crime.

the old map showed a network of backstreets long since disappeared.
